Day 1 of our Disney trip
We woke up early on Thursday. When I say early I mean up at 6 am and at the bus stop at 7. In line for park opening by 7:30. Our plan was to kind of warm the kiddos up to the rides and start out easy. That plan went to crap when we found out a good portion of the park wouldn't open for another hour. So, we did space mountain. Most of the kiddos liked it. Sophs cried but said she would go on again the next time we come. We then hit up nearly all of the other rides, ate lunch, then returned to our hotel for a little rest. Dinner reservations were at o'hana at the polynesian resort. Dinner was amazing. We had chicken, steak, shrimp, dumplings, salad, pineapple bread, and a wonderful bread pudding. After dinner we took the monorail over to the Magic Kingdom for the Not So Scary Halloween Party. We dressed as a basketball team, cheerleaders, a referee, and a coach. The Halloween parade was awesome. We also got to trick or treat around the park and let me tell you, the cast was not stingy with the candy. We were out until 11:30.
